What happens if you withdraw from WGU?
Students with a withdrawal date that occurs up through the completion of 60% of a term are eligible for a refund of a prorated portion of the tuition and library fee. Students with a withdrawal date that occurs after 60% of the term has been completed are not eligible for a refund.

How many classes can you take a semester at WGU?
The mentors will only allow you to put about 3 courses per semester (appx. 12 hours) into your degree plan to make sure that you achieve "satisfactory on time progress." You'll then add each additional course as you progress through but there are no limits.

Does WGU prorated tuition?
Students who withdraw from WGU or stop progress through the 60% point of a six-month term of enrollment for which tuition is assessed will receive a prorated tuition refund. After that point, there is no provision for a refund. No fees will be refunded or prorated.
Do employers take WGU seriously?
According to a survey involving 300 participants, all of which are employers of WGU graduates: 98%: Employers who said WGU graduates have met or exceeded their expectations. 96%: Employers who said they would hire more WGU graduates. 95%: Employers who said the WGU graduates they hired were well-prepared for the job.
Is a degree from Western Governors University worth anything?
The average time it takes to graduate from WGU is about two years and three months for a bachelor's degree, which would cost roughly $15,000. Within four years of graduation, the average WGU graduate sees a boost in annual salary of nearly $20,000, according to WGU data.
Is WGU a degree mill?
Is WGU a diploma mill? No. WGU is a regionally accredited institution, with the same accreditation as traditional universities. WGU is also a non-profit university, which can help you feel confident that our focus is on your education, not toward a corporate bottom line.
How long is a semester at WGU?
six monthsA term at WGU is six months in length. The six months that make up your term are based on when you begin your program. For example, if you begin your program March 1st, your first term lasts from March 1st to August 31st.
